400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> 软件攻略 > 文章详情

matlab如何加注释

作者:路由通
|
198人看过
发布时间:2025-12-18 22:32:53
标签:
本文全面解析矩阵实验室软件注释使用方法,涵盖十二个核心要点。从基础的单行多行注释语法到注释规范最佳实践,深入探讨注释对代码可读性、调试效率和团队协作的重要作用,并介绍自动化注释工具和文档生成技术,帮助开发者提升编程专业水平。
matlab如何加注释

       在矩阵实验室软件开发环境中,注释功能远非简单的代码说明工具,而是贯穿于程序设计、开发调试、维护升级全生命周期的关键实践。恰当使用注释不仅能提升代码可读性,更能显著降低团队协作成本,提高软件开发质量。本文将系统阐述矩阵实验室环境中注释应用的完整方法论体系,涵盖基础语法、高级技巧、规范标准及实用工具,为开发者提供全面指导。

       注释符号基础用法

       矩阵实验室中使用百分号作为单行注释的标识符,这是最基础且使用频率最高的注释方式。在代码行中任何位置出现的百分号都会使其后直至行末的内容被解释器忽略执行。这种注释方式适用于对单行代码的功能说明、参数解释或临时禁用特定语句。需要注意的是,百分号注释仅作用于单行,若需要跨行注释则需每行单独添加百分号,这是与其他编程语言中块注释特性最大的区别。

       多行注释实现方案

       虽然矩阵实验室没有提供专用的多行注释语法,但开发者可以通过百分比符号与花括号的组合实现块注释效果。具体而言,使用花括号包裹百分号的方式可以创建视觉上的注释块,但这种形式本质上仍是多个单行注释的集合。从软件版本开始,矩阵实验室引入了区块注释功能,允许用户通过菜单操作或快捷键快速注释多行代码,这在实际开发中大大提高了注释效率。

       函数文件头注释规范

       函数定义处的文件头注释具有特殊意义,这些注释内容可以通过帮助命令直接显示给用户。规范的函数头注释应包含函数名称、功能描述、输入输出参数说明、使用示例和作者信息等要素。矩阵实验室的帮助系统会自动识别函数文件开头的连续注释块,并将其作为该函数的官方文档显示。这种机制使得编写详细的函数头注释成为函数开发过程中不可或缺的环节。

       脚本文件注释标准

       脚本文件的注释应当包含文件用途、实现原理、版本历史和使用注意事项等关键信息。与函数注释不同,脚本注释更注重整体流程的说明而非接口定义。建议在脚本开头使用注释块建立标准化文件头,包含创建日期、最后修改时间、作者联系方式和版权声明等信息。这种规范化注释实践对于代码维护和团队协作具有重要意义。

       代码节注释技巧

       使用双百分号加空格的方式创建节注释是矩阵实验室编辑器的特色功能。这种注释格式不仅具有更好的视觉辨识度,还能与编辑器的节运行功能配合使用。通过在节注释后添加百分比百分比实现代码分节,用户可以独立运行特定节的代码,这在调试和演示时极为便捷。合理使用节注释可以将大型脚本模块化,提高代码的组织性和可维护性。

       注释与代码调试

       注释在调试过程中发挥着重要作用。通过临时注释掉可能出错的代码段,开发者可以采用排除法定位问题源。矩阵实验室编辑器提供的批量注释功能允许快速注释或取消注释选中的多行代码,这比手动添加删除百分号更加高效。建议在调试过程中保留被注释掉的旧代码而非直接删除,这样既方便回溯修改历史,也能在需要时快速恢复原有逻辑。

       注释内容写作原则

       高质量的注释应当遵循明确性、简洁性和相关性的原则。注释内容应着重说明代码的设计意图和实现逻辑,而非简单重复代码表面的操作。避免使用模糊的表述如“这里进行计算”,而应明确说明计算的目的和算法选择理由。同时,注释应及时更新以保持与代码实际功能的一致性,过时或错误的注释比没有注释更具误导性。

       自动化注释工具

       矩阵实验室提供了多种自动化注释辅助工具。代码分析器可以检查注释的完整性和一致性,并标识出缺少注释的复杂代码段。编辑器模板功能允许用户创建自定义注释模板,快速生成标准化的注释块。此外,通过应用程序设计接口可以编程方式访问和修改注释内容,这为大规模代码库的注释管理提供了自动化解决方案。

       文档生成技术

       基于注释的文档生成是现代化软件开发的重要实践。矩阵实验室支持从代码注释中提取内容生成标准格式的技术文档。通过使用特定格式的注释标签,如查看命令和属性说明,可以生成包含函数列表、参数说明和示例代码的专业文档。这种将代码与文档紧密结合的方式确保了文档的及时性和准确性,极大减少了独立编写维护文档的工作量。

       注释与版本控制

       在版本控制系统中,注释发挥着记录代码变更历史的作用。除了系统自动生成的提交信息外,代码内部的注释应详细记录重要修改的原因和背景。建议在重大修改处添加修改日期、修改人和修改目的的注释,这样即使查看旧版本代码也能清晰了解演变历程。这种实践对于长期维护的项目尤为重要,可以有效降低新成员理解代码的成本。

       国际化注释方案

       对于需要支持多语言环境的项目,注释的国际化处理显得尤为重要。矩阵实验室提供了多种本地化支持机制,允许根据系统语言设置显示相应的注释内容。虽然注释本身不会直接影响程序执行,但多语言注释可以帮助跨国团队成员更好地理解代码逻辑。建议核心模块同时提供多种语言的注释,或者至少保证英文注释的完整性和准确性。

       注释性能考量

       尽管注释在程序执行时会被完全忽略,但过多的注释会影响文件加载和解析的速度。对于大型项目,建议平衡注释的详细程度和文件大小之间的关系。矩阵实验室在解析文件时会跳过所有注释内容,因此注释不会影响运行时性能。但在极少数情况下,包含大量注释的脚本文件可能在加载时稍有延迟,这在普通开发中通常可以忽略不计。

       注释最佳实践总结

       综合以上各点,优秀的注释实践应当做到:注释与代码同步更新,保持内容准确;使用清晰规范的语言表达,避免歧义;重点注释算法复杂度和设计决策,而非 obvious 操作;保持适当的注释密度,既不过少导致理解困难,也不过多影响阅读流畅性。通过建立团队统一的注释规范和定期检查机制,可以确保代码库中注释的质量一致性。

       正确使用注释是专业程序员的基本素养,在矩阵实验室开发环境中尤其如此。通过系统化的注释实践,不仅可以提高个人开发效率,更能促进团队协作和知识传承。希望本文提供的注释方法和技巧能够帮助读者提升代码质量,开发出更易于维护和扩展的优质程序。

相关文章
长虹空调f6是什么意思
长虹空调显示屏出现F6代码代表室外机环境温度传感器异常。本文深度解析F6故障的十二个核心维度:从传感器工作原理到具体故障表现,从用户自查步骤到专业维修方案,涵盖断电复位技巧、万用表检测方法、传感器更换流程及预防措施。文章结合官方技术资料提供阶梯式解决方案,帮助用户快速判断问题严重程度并采取正确处置措施,有效延长空调使用寿命。
2025-12-18 22:32:20
253人看过
什么是散热片
散热片是一种通过增大接触面积来加速热量散发的装置,广泛应用于电子设备、机械系统等领域。本文将从材料特性、结构设计、工作原理等角度,系统解析散热片的分类标准、性能参数及选型要点,并结合实际应用场景分析其优化策略与发展趋势。
2025-12-18 22:32:02
306人看过
500m流量多少钱
五百兆流量的价格并非固定数值,其成本受运营商资费体系、用户套餐类型、购买渠道及使用场景等多重因素影响。本文通过剖析四大运营商现行资费结构,对比不同套餐的流量单价差异,并结合短期包与定向流量的性价比,为消费者提供精准的选购策略。同时揭示隐藏资费陷阱,预判未来流量资费趋势,帮助用户实现流量成本最优化管理。
2025-12-18 22:31:09
116人看过
华为员工有多少人
华为作为全球领先的信息与通信技术解决方案供应商,其员工规模一直备受关注。根据华为投资控股有限公司最新年度报告,截至2023年12月31日,华为全球员工总数约为20.7万人,业务遍及170多个国家和地区。公司坚持“以奋斗者为本”的核心价值观,研发人员占比超过55%,持续推动技术创新与产业发展。
2025-12-18 22:30:52
349人看过
excel函数占比用什么公式
本文详细解析表格处理软件中计算占比的12种核心函数公式,从基础除法运算到条件求和、多层级占比计算,结合数据透视表与可视化技巧,全面覆盖日常办公场景需求。每个公式均配以实际案例说明,帮助用户快速掌握数据比例分析的实用方法。
2025-12-18 22:14:51
389人看过
word文档为什么会整体缩进
本文将深入分析Word文档整体缩进的十二种常见原因,从页面设置异常、样式模板问题到隐藏格式符号影响,结合微软官方技术文档提供专业解决方案,帮助用户彻底理解并修复文档排版异常问题。
2025-12-18 22:13:48
90人看过